Visas & Flights

Please note that citizens from African countries can travel to Ghana Visa-free. Citizens from outside of Africa require a visa to enter Ghana, except those from Jamaica, Trinidad and Tobago, and Barbados. Upon request, invitation letters can be sent to delegates to support their visa applications

All international flights arrive at Kotoka International Airport, just 10km from the Accra city centre. Airlines servicing Kotoka International Airport include:  RwandAir, Ethiopian Airlines, Kenya Airways, Ethiopian Airlines, Brussels Airlines, KLM, Qatar Airways and Turkish Airlines. Getting Around Accra

The most popular ride-hailing app in Accra is the Uber App , mostly because it is less expensive than the standard taxi services that charge $10 – $15 for a 10 minute drive. Other ride-hailing companies operating in Ghana include Bolt and Yango. Accra is a small city and taxis/cabs are not difficult to come by either at the airport or across the city. Taxis are available 24 hours a day at Kotoka International Airport.  The official rates from the airport is $15.
